Trends of experimental mechanics

Jacek Stupnicki
The present contribution aims at presentation of modern trends of experimental mechanics as well as fields of greatest activity and advanced experimental methods enabling acquisition of yet unattainable or more reliable information.

Widespread application of experimental methods observed nowadays has emerged as a result of linear approach limits being reached, together with the necessity for new states and processess to be observed. On the other hand, it should be noted that experimental methods have been developed rapidlly for the last decade due to application of the techniques used till now only in physical laboratories, revealing new capabilities emerging from advanced computer methods of data acquisition and data processing.

The survey has been made basing on over thirty papers presented in 1993-94 at most representative conferences on experimental mechanics.
